[QUOTE="Salix, post: 2814249, member: 40003"] #1 Salix Mission - Help Wanted: Exterminators, Philly, No Experience Neccessary (Velmont Judging) -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- This is the thread for the mission being run by Salix. This boilerplate info was stolen from Bront. In addition to any normal IC post you may make I request that your first post have a link to your character sheet (Yeah, I know not that hard to find, but good habit to get into) in it, any disadvantages or complications you may have, and any other notes you feel I should be aware of. I expect 4-6 heroes, and hope that they'll be able to post at least once a day, but more is always better. if you will be gone for a spell, just inform me. I will RP your character where appropriate. When posting, please color your text with a different color than everyone else (I prefer dark colors), and feel free to use line/paragraph breaks to break up chunks of your documents. Also, familiarize yourself with the usage of SBLOCK and SPOILER. I use SBLOCKs more often, particularly to hide OOC comments or for items for specific people only.Keep OOC posts to a minimum. Usually some IC content can be tied to an OOC post. The Briefing will begin when enough people have filed into the room. Players should feel free to use Invisible Castle to make rolls. [url]http://invisiblecastle.com/rolldice.py[/url] [U]PCs[/U] Gun Monkey Toad Roughneck Pandora Body and Spirit [U]NPCs[/U] Mr. Kyle Wheeler- team handler King- head of aircraft maintenance/flight operations Dick- jet pilot Mr. Robert Malina- Philadelphia DA Mr. Daniel Sisselman-Philadelphia assistant DA Mr. John Rivera--Philadelphia Chief of Police Robert Wallace-Investigative reporter based in Philadelphia, but looking to break into the national spotlight [U]Villains[/U] Dr. Null- Genius madman intent on world domination Bugbots-mechanical devices capable of creating replicas of themselves from scrap Tripod Walker- a 60 foot vehicle used by Null original post in ready lounge thread that starts adventure A red light begins to flash above the monitors in the room. All of the TV monitors display the same image. The volume of all the monitors turns up until the audio is loud enough for Roughneck to hear in the fitting room. “This is Robert Wallace, high in the sky in the Channel Four Action News Copter!”” “We’re broadcasting live from above the Walt Whitman Bridge in Philadelphia, and I’m telling you it ’s a madhouse down there! Take it from me folks, it’s going to be more than the usual rush hour slow down today! ” “There ’s a swarm of … what look like bugs, big metal bugs, crawling up out of the Delaware River. Each one is as big as a car. They climbed right up the bridge tower,and now they ’re spread out across the road,right in the middle of traffic. All lanes have screeched to a halt, and there are collisions and fender-benders everywhere!” Sorry folks >bbrrzzz< we ’re getting a lot of brrzzz< (FFred! can’t you clean up that signal?) ) There’s some kind of interference… brrzzzzzzzz< ” The clip is continually replayed. The chopper is unable to send a visual feed so there is a stock photo of the WW bridge (see attached photo). It is apparently the only clip of the situation as new info is not appearing. An announcement comes over the intercom system: All available Resolutes report to the breifing room! OOC: This is a short adventure that is meant for a single nights play. It is open to anyone and will be a chance for characters to play their characters and see how they will do before a longer adventure presents itself. Velmont will judge. As a warning I've never GM'ed mutants and masterminds before so this will be a chance for me to get some experience with a pretty straightforward adventure. This adventure is based on the published adventure: Dr. Null:Battle of the Bay Bridge. If you've played that it is still probably alright to participate in this one although you will be expected to play your character without the benefit of any knowledge you might have. I'm hoping to have a post rate of at least once per day.
